STONEY NAKODA— After seeing a rapid increase of COVID-19 cases in Stoney Nakoda First Nation a State of Local Emergency has been declared.
On Monday (Jan. 11), the Nation saw an increase of 17 active cases bringing the Nation’s current active cases to 103. There have been four COVID-related deaths in the Nation to date.
An immediate State of Local Emergency and Necessary Procedures was declared on Monday to help bend the curve of infection in the Nation given the unprecedented increase in COVID-19 positive cases.
